Main Themes:
- Academic Excellence: The University of Edinburgh (UoE) positions itself as a prestigious institution committed to world-class research and education. They highlight their consistent top global ranking for research output.
- Diversity and Inclusion: UoE emphasises its commitment to fostering a diverse and inclusive academic community, actively encouraging applications from underrepresented groups.
- Supportive Environment: The university underscores its dedication to the professional development of its faculty, offering resources like mentoring programs and research grants.
- Interdisciplinary Collaboration: UoE promotes interdisciplinary research and collaboration, enabling academics to engage with diverse perspectives and address complex challenges.
- Unique Blend of Tradition and Innovation: The university highlights its rich history alongside its commitment to cutting-edge research, creating a stimulating and inclusive environment.
- Vibrant Location: Situated in Edinburgh, a city renowned for its cultural vibrancy and historical significance, UoE offers an attractive quality of life.
- Global Impact: The university emphasizes the global impact of its research and graduates, contributing to discoveries, innovations, and societal advancements.
Key Facts and Ideas:
- Application Process: Prospective candidates are directed to the official UoE website for comprehensive information on available positions, application procedures, and qualifications.
- Notable Alumni: UoE boasts a legacy of producing influential figures, including Charles Darwin, Sir Walter Scott, and Sir James Clerk Maxwell.
